February 12, 1948: Shaikh Saqr Bin Mohammad Al Qasimi becomes the Ruler of Ras Al Khaimah

February 9, 1972: Shaikh Saqr decides to join the Ras Al Khaimah in the UAE Federation

April 15, 1987: He issued directives to build more dams in Wadi Al Gour

November 19, 1987: He inaugurates Ras Al Khaimah National Museum

August 28, 1988: He ordered the Studies and Documents Centre of Ras Al Khaimah to preserve historical manuscripts

November 10, 1988: Shaikh Saqr issued an Emiri decree creating a new Municipal Council to be chaired by Shaikh Saud Bin Saqr Al Qasimi.

October 06, 1992: He inaugurates a heritage museum in Ras Al Khaimah

May 21, 1997: He attends the graduation ceremony of the 7th batch of Islamic Sharia diploma holders

December 1, 1997: He opens the new Dh105 million water desalination plant

May 9, 1998: He inaugurates the Etisalat tower

August 25, 1998: He bans hunting of birds and hares in Ras Al Khaimah

April 27, 1999: He issues a decree to establish of environment protection and industrial development authority in the emirate

April 28, 1999: He inaugurates Julphar II, a pharmaceutical factory specialising in producing antibiotics

July 5, 1999: He issues a decree to formal establishment of Al Ittihad University in Ras Al Khaimah

April 10, 2000: He orders the renovation of all the old houses in the remote Galeelah area at his own expense

May 9, 2000: He issues two laws on the establishment of Ras Al Khaimah Radio and Television Corporation and the creation of a free trade zone

June 14, 2003: Shaikh Saqr appoints Shaikh Saud Bin Saqr Al Qasimi as the Crown Prince of Ras Al Khaimah

October 26, 2004: He sets up the Shaikh Saqr Programme for Governmental Excellence, a new programme would support quality and creativity in the performance of the local departments

November 10, 2004:  He establishes the Ras Al Khaimah Charity Organisation aimed at extending financial support to needy families

March 7, 2005: He issues a decree to establish the RAK Real Estate Co with an initial capital of Dh2 billion

April 13, 2005: He issues a decree to establish the Ras Al Khaimah Investment Authority

February 13, 2006: Shaikh Saqr issues a decree to setting up the RAK Airways as a national airway with a paid up capital of Dh850 million

February 17, 2006: He grants clearance to Space Adventures Ltd to operate a suborbital vehicle from the emirate

February 18, 2006: He sets up the RAK Education Company (EDRAK), a Dh1.5b education firm invest in “all educational opportunities of all types and at all levels anywhere.”

April 22, 2007: He issues a decree setting up the RAK Transport Authority as an independent public body

February 1, 2008: He issues a decree organising the registration and licensing of travel and tourism companies in the emirate
